As part of completion "Management of packaging waste in the Western Balkans" project, which was implemented in Bosnia and Herzegovina, Serbia and North Macedonia, a final conference was organized in Belgrade in which we participated along with representatives of local communities and their utility companies involved in this project. At the conference, it was pointed out that BiH had an excellent result in the improvement of the infrastructure for the collection of glass packaging wasteas well in implementingour public advocacy campaign.

Also, as part of this project, Ekopak in cooperation with GIZ procured and delivered 190 special waste-bins for the disposal of glass packaging waste for the pilot cities and municipalities, i.e. for the City of Bihać and the municipalities of Novi Travnik, Konjic and Ilidža with the help of its partner utility companies. They ensured the collection and transportation of collected quantities for recycling. A total of 208,000 kg of glass packaging waste was submitted for recycling from these four local communities in Bosnia and Herzegovina: 114,000 kg from Novi Travnik, more than 64,000 kg  from Bihać, 19,000 kg Konjic and 11,000 kg from Ilidža. In total 7% more than our project goal.
